Global Veterinary Immunodiagnostics Market size was valued at USD 2.92 Billion in 2024 and is poised to grow from USD 3.16 Billion in 2025 to USD 5.89 Billion by 2033, growing at a CAGR of 8.1% during the forecast period (2026-2033).
The global veterinary immunodiagnostics market is poised for growth driven by the increasing prevalence of animal diseases, enhanced access to specialized immunodiagnostic tests, and advancements in technology. The surge in pet ownership and demand for animal-derived food products further bolster market expansion. Emerging economies present promising opportunities for growth; however, the market faces challenges stemming from inadequate veterinary diagnostic infrastructure in these regions. Additionally, the heightened focus on testing due to the global pandemic has spurred the development of novel animal testing solutions by industry players and laboratories. While major health organizations do not endorse routine COVID-19 testing in animals, decisions regarding testing may arise from evolving public health circumstances, necessitating collective judgments by veterinarians and health officials.

Driver of the Global Veterinary Immunodiagnostics Market
The Global Veterinary Immunodiagnostics market is significantly driven by the pressing need to address serious zoonotic illnesses that can be transmitted from animals to humans. With numerous pathogens originating from livestock and companion animals, such as dogs and cats, the potential for disease transmission is high. Notable zoonotic infections, including rabies, leptospirosis, and gastrointestinal diseases, highlight the necessity for effective diagnostic solutions in veterinary medicine. As awareness of these health risks grows, the demand for advanced immunodiagnostic tools becomes increasingly vital to ensure public and animal health, ultimately propelling market growth and innovation in veterinary diagnostics.
Restraints in the Global Veterinary Immunodiagnostics Market
The rising expenses associated with pet care are a notable restraint in the Global Veterinary Immunodiagnostics market. Veterinary care has become one of the largest cost categories within the pet care industry, reflecting a significant financial burden for pet owners. The increasing prices of high-end procedures can be staggering, often ranging from thousands to tens of thousands of dollars. Additionally, even routine veterinary services can lead to considerable expenditures, ranging from a few hundred to several thousand dollars. This growing financial pressure may deter pet owners from seeking necessary diagnostic services, ultimately impacting the overall demand in this market.
